Radio propagation is the behavior of radio waves as they travel, or are propagated, from one point to another in vacuum, or into various parts of the atmosphere. As a form of electromagnetic radiation, like light waves, radio waves are affected by the phenomena of reflection, refraction, diffraction, absorption, polarization, and scattering. The information is imposed on the electromagnetic … WebScience. WiFi signals aren't straight beams. It's better to compare it to ripples in a pond when you throw a pebble in. The ripples propagate in all directions from the source. They get weaker the further they get. Obstacles along the way can block the ripple or alter it and the ripples may get reflected by barriers.
